What A Kia Electric Vehicle Offers Today

A Kia electric vehicle gives you instant power, fewer moving parts, and advanced cabin features designed around driver control. Unlike traditional gas engines, electric motors deliver torque instantly, which means faster response when merging, accelerating, or navigating city traffic. You also get a smoother ride without engine noise or gear shifts.

Charging networks keep expanding across the country. Kia's electric models now support fast charging, with select versions gaining most of their range in under 30 minutes. If you plan your routes right and know where high-speed stations are located, electric range becomes manageable for longer trips. Most daily driving needs fall well within the typical range of today’s electric powertrains.

Interior design on electric models also changes how drivers interact with their vehicles. Digital displays stretch across the dash and replace traditional buttons with smarter controls. Cabin layouts focus more on open space and storage since there’s no transmission tunnel or large engine block to work around.

Better Efficiency Without Sacrificing Function

Efficiency no longer means weak performance. The EV6 and EV9 give you all-wheel drive options with strong horsepower and high towing capacity. You get the benefits of a traditional SUV without constant fuel stops. Battery management systems have become smarter, allowing consistent output and better long-term range retention.

Kia’s electric lineup includes multiple body styles. You can pick between crossovers, full-size SUVs, or future utility trucks based on how much space or capability you need. Regenerative braking helps charge the battery while you drive and can reduce wear on the brake system over time.

Since there’s no internal combustion engine, oil changes and transmission repairs disappear from your maintenance schedule. That brings down long-term ownership costs while also giving you fewer things to track. Climate control systems also run more efficiently and support better temperature management inside the cabin.

Charging And Daily Use

Charging at home gives you more control over your schedule. Most electric vehicle owners install a Level 2 charger in their garage, which can fully charge overnight. Public charging stations work well for top-offs or long road trips. Kia's in-vehicle navigation includes charger locations and status updates so you can find what you need fast.

Smartphone integration allows remote start, cabin pre-conditioning, and range monitoring. You can check your charge status from anywhere or set charging times to take advantage of off-peak electricity rates. These tools help you build a simple routine around electric ownership.

Electric vehicles also meet state and federal incentive standards, which can lower your total cost depending on current offers. These rebates make it easier to move into EV ownership without pushing past your original budget.
